Why Choose Awnings for Homes?
Awnings serve not only as protective coverings but also as design elements that enhance the aesthetic appeal of a house. Here are key reasons to consider installing awnings for houses:
- Protection from the Elements: Shield against harsh sunlight and rain, prolonging the life of your outdoor furniture.
- Energy Efficiency: Reduce indoor temperatures by blocking direct sunlight, which can lower air conditioning costs.
- Enhanced Outdoor Living: Create a comfortable outdoor space that can be enjoyed regardless of the weather.
Types of Awnings and Their Uses
Before selecting the perfect awning canopy for your home, it’s vital to understand the different types available:
- Retractable Awnings: Ideal for awnings for homes where flexibility is desired. Adjust them easily to control light and shade.
- Stationary Awnings: Perfect for long-term, consistent coverage. Great for patios and decks.
- Portable Awnings: Easy to install and move, suitable for temporary setups.

FAQs About Awnings and Canopies
- What materials are best for awnings?
Awnings and canopies often use fabric, vinyl, metal, or polycarbonate. The choice depends on the balance between durability, aesthetics, and budget. - How much maintenance is required?
Regular cleaning and inspection to ensure there are no damages from elements. Retractable models may need occasional gear or motor checking. - Can I install an awning myself?
While DIY installation is possible, hiring an awning contractor tends to guarantee safety and optimal performance.
